  • Description: Provides resources, training, referrals, activities and more for the blind and visually impaired. Services include:
    • Counseling
    • Instruction in adaptive daily living skills
    • Hosts discussion and support groups for clients as well as family and friends
    • Listening and large print library services available
    • Closed circuit TV to magnify written material for easy reading
    • Teaches cane travel (mobility)
    • Adaptive daily living skills
    • Low vision exams
    • Outreach services
    • Tech Training instruction
